A lively brush-pen style with a consistent rightward slant and slightly compressed proportions. Strokes show moderate contrast with tapered entries and exits, and the edges retain a subtle dry-brush texture that keeps the forms organic rather than polished. Letterforms are mostly unconnected, with open counters and simplified construction that favors speed and gesture over strict symmetry. The rhythm is slightly irregular in width and stroke finish, reinforcing an authentic handwritten look while remaining readable in words and short lines.
Best suited to short to medium-length text where personality matters—headlines, pull quotes, posters, packaging callouts, and social media graphics. It can also work for casual branding accents and menu-style typography when set with comfortable spacing and sufficient size.
The overall tone feels casual and upbeat, like quick marker lettering for notes, menus, or personal messages. Its energetic slant and textured stroke ends add a sense of motion and spontaneity, giving text a friendly, informal presence.
The design appears intended to capture fast, natural brush handwriting in a font that stays legible while preserving the imperfections and texture of real strokes. It prioritizes expressive rhythm and an informal voice over geometric precision.
Capitals are assertive and airy, while the lowercase maintains a quick, single-stroke feel with occasional looped or hooked terminals. Numerals follow the same brush rhythm and tapering, matching well in mixed alphanumeric settings.
